@PublicEvolving
public class FlinkKafkaConsumer09<T>
extends org.apache.flink.streaming.connectors.kafka.FlinkKafkaConsumerBase<T>
The Flink Kafka Consumer participates in checkpointing and guarantees that no data is lost during a failure, and that the computation processes elements "exactly once". (Note: These guarantees naturally assume that Kafka itself does not loose any data.)
Please note that Flink snapshots the offsets internally as part of its distributed checkpoints. The offsets committed to Kafka / ZooKeeper are only to bring the outside view of progress in sync with Flink's view of the progress. That way, monitoring and other jobs can get a view of how far the Flink Kafka consumer has consumed a topic.

If partition discovery is enabled (by setting a non-negative value for
FlinkKafkaConsumerBase.KEY_PARTITION_DISCOVERY_INTERVAL_MILLIS in the properties), topics
with names matching the pattern will also be subscribed to as they are created on the fly.
